自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

转载 相机和相册的调用

1.申请权限  2.获取路径 3.显示效果layout<?xml version="1.0" encoding="utf-8"?><android.support.constraint.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http:/...

2018-03-17 11:20:06 341

转载 通知栏

通知(Notification)是Android系统中比较有特色的一个功能,当某个应用程序希望向用户发出一些提示信息,而该应用程序又不在前台运行时,就可以借助通知来实现。发出一条通知后,手机最上方的状态栏中会显示一个通知的图标,下拉状态栏后可以看到通知的详细内容。通过NotificationManager来对通知进行管理,可以调用Context的getSystemService()方法获取到。ge...

2018-03-15 11:26:13 251

转载 内容提供器

内容提供器(Content Provider)主要用于在不同的应用程序之间实现数据共享的功能,它提供了一套完整的机制,允许一个程序访问另一个程序中的数据,同时还能保证被访数据的安全性。内容提供器可以选择只对哪一部分数据进行共享,从而保证我们程序中的隐私数据不会有泄漏的风险。但是使用内容提供器需要用到运行时权限。需要在Manifest里申请行管权限在Android6.0及以上,出来申请权限意外。还需...

2018-03-15 08:44:00 238

转载 SharedPreferences存/读数据

SharedPreferences是一种以键-值来对数据进行操作的功能存入通过Button进行点击事件SharedPreferencesv 本身对数据没有写入的功能,而是通过内部的接口调用Edit(),方法来写入.然后利用Put__来进行键值设置.最后通过apply()来进行数据传输 button.setOnClickListener(new View.OnClickListener() { ...

2018-03-14 12:15:18 275

转载 文本文件数据输入与读取

步骤1两个Edittext用来作为输入和获取的媒介<android.support.constraint.ConstraintL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:to...

2018-03-14 11:08:11 669

转载 本地广播

为了能够简单地解决广播的安全性问题,Android引入了一套本地广播机制,使用这个机制发出的广播只能够在应用程序的内部进行传递,并且广播接收器也只能接收来自本应用程序发出的广播,这样所有的安全性问题就都不存在了。本地广播的用法并不复杂,主要就是使用了一个LocalBroadcastManager来对广播进行管理,并提供了发送广播和注册广播接收器的方法。下面我们就通过具体的实例来尝试一下它的用法,修...

2018-03-13 16:37:28 247

转载 BroadcastReceiver的标准式与有序式

标准AndriodStudio里,点击包右键→New→Other→Broadcast Receiver。其中Exported属性表示是否允许这个广播接收器接收本程序以外的广播,Enabled属性表示是否启用这个广播接收器。勾选这两个属性,点击Finish完成创建。步骤1public class broadcastreceiver extends BroadcastReceiver { @...

2018-03-13 16:24:13 194

转载 BroadcastReceiver的动态加载与静态加载

广播由 发送广播和广播接收器两部分.无论是静态还是动态都需要在Manifest里申请权限,否则将会导致崩溃动态加载以广播网络状态为例生成广播需要注册,需要两个参数 BroadcastReceiver和IntenFilter(筛选式Intent)registerReceiver(networkChangeReceiver,intentFilter);//含义 广播接收器和筛选指定的广播所以在Act...

2018-03-13 10:11:49 454

原创 Fragment的应用

碎片是一种微型的活动,一般由多个碎片合并到一个Activity中显示.营造一个更好的UI界面简单实例:步骤1新建一个left_layout<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+id/left" android:layout_width="ma...

2018-03-12 09:55:17 205

转载 RecycleView的使用

几个重要的类在我们开始讲解RecyclerView的用法之前,我们要先认识几个它常用的内部类,因为这几个内部类很重要,贯穿整个使用过程:1、RecyclerView.Adapter:抽象类,为RecyclerView提供数据,一般根据不同的业务需求来编写具体的实现类。2、RecyclerView.LayoutManager:抽象类,主要用于测量RecyclerView的子Item,以及根据不同的布...

2018-03-11 12:43:22 265

转载 ListView与ArrayAdapter用法,以及自定义

步骤1在相应的layout文件中加入ListVIew组件<ListView android:id="@+id/Listview" android:layout_width="match_parent" android:layout_height="match_parent" app:layout_constraintBottom...

2018-03-10 14:46:51 375

转载 ProgressBard功能操作

ProgressBar用于在界面上显示一个进度条,表示我们的程序正在加载一些数据.在相应的Layout文件中加入 <ProgressBar android:id="@+id/progressBar" style="?android:attr/progressBarStyle" android:layout_width="wrap_content...

2018-03-09 15:53:30 345

转载 隐式Itent的用法

启动另一个活动步骤1:找到AndroidManifest.在要被响应的活动里加上 <action>和<category><intent-filter> <action android:name="com.example.activitytest.ACTION_START" />//可自定义 <c...

2018-03-09 13:22:17 362

转载 让menu显示在Toolbar中

在style.xml里,把parent修改为如下<style name="AppTheme" parent="Theme.AppCompat.Light.NoActionBar">让后在layout里给布局加上一个Toolbar<android.support.v7.widget.Toolbar android:id="@+id/toolbar" ...

2018-03-09 11:35:43 414

原创 Android Studio监听事件匿名内部类的方法及注意事项

步骤1:   导入监听包步骤2: prot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_last); Button button=(Button)findViewByI...

2018-03-09 10:22:00 2752

原创 关于Andriod Studio在真机测试中无法安装Apk的问题解决方案

 INSTALL_FAILED_INSUFFICIENT_STORAGE解决方案:真机的Rom内存不足,清空一些数据或应用即可.

2018-03-09 10:02:37 2558

转载 bootstrap写的第一个应用1

先创建三个文件夹,Template(存放html文件),assets(存放图片及css文件),js(存放JS文件).此应用使用Sublime编写。创建三个HTML文件Home_index.html,Home_about.html,Home_case.html.和准备好图片素材.Home_indexBootstrap 实例 - 默认的导航栏

2017-03-31 13:32:41 370

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除